Le nostre barche sono ormeggiate all'interno di Ward Cove, che un tempo era il sito del più grande mulino di pasta per carta negli Stati Uniti. I resti del vecchio mulino per polpa possono essere visti all'arrivo al nostro molo, oltre che dall'acqua. Imparerai a conoscere le industrie che una volta alimentavano Ketchikan mentre lasciamo il nostro bacino alle spalle e ci dirigiamo verso acque più selvagge.

Visualizza la più grande foresta pluviale temperata del mondo dall'acqua. Percorriamo la costa selvaggia delle nostre isole remote, densamente popolate da abeti rossi Sitka, Western Hemlock, cedro rosso e giallo e ontano rosso.
